Présents: Guillaume, Patrick, Laurent, Myriam, JB, Gilles, Denis, Xavier
Situation/recapitulatif technique du projet
En cours / reste à faire par l'equipe technique
Point infrastructure
La majorité des éléments sont acquis au niveau de l'équipe technique pour les aspects machines, stockage, sauvegardes et procédures associées.
Plus de développement nécessaire, restent seulement quelques actions techniques dans la check-list ci-dessous et suivre /synchroniser le code actuel avec les briques externes.
Points développement
L'outil mûrit côté backend. Mais de nombreux points restent à compléter et restera encore un moment pour stabiliser le tout avec une V1.1.
Ci-dessous les points devant être traités en priorité.
- Soumission :
- fait pour #636 : keywords, commentaires (par granule une fois soumises)
- reste pour #636 :
- rajout metadata : obs_id, quality_flag
- La gestion des données sous embargo (création du widget) et des droits d'accès privé aux utilisateurs n'est pas prioritaire pour OIDB 1.0.
- le ticket #648 devrait être ok: re-tester et fermer
- keywords : fait mais sans les 6 checkbox , ca va ?
- il reste du travail pour la validation : #607
- Modifications de granules/fichiers :
- modification obs_release_date /data_rights
- Gestion des utilisateurs:
- groupes, pas prioritaire
- Normalisation/regroupement des differentes ecritures de datapi ( pour CHARA, action en attente: Chris F.)
- affichage de l'email de contact
- Doublons
- cookie d'acceptation des regles d'utilisation. Dans un premier temps, faire une simple bannière.
- Commentaires:
- étendre la notion dispo pour les granules, aux collections, fichiers oifits
- Mettre en place les pages facilities, instruments, data pis
- Modif du DM:
- Mise a jour des URL:
- relocalisation
- masquage systematique derriere url de redirection (stats)
- amélioration de la protection des données pionier ( les pi doivent pouvoir acceder à leurs données )
Définition des spécifications
- quality_flag:
- Comme dans beacoup de base de données, la qualité est estimé de différente manière au moyen de notes. Dans OIDB, des notes de 0-5 sont attribuées subjectivement et doivent indiquer si l'on peut s'y fier, pour alimenter des logiciel d'analyse de données notamment: note 4 et 5 (ticket #579).
- Il serait bon d'indiquer si l'estimation de qualité a été faite par un humain ou une machine.
- Faut-il incorporer la qualité des metadata dans ce quality_flag ?
- pb email -> si un DataPI ne veut pas afficher son email, le gestionnaire de la facilité associée prendra le relai (ex. Theo pour Chara)
- programmer la rencontre avec Strasbourg pour les aspect DM ( Xavier sera en France du 15 mars au 10 avril )
- proposer un choix de licence
- les licences de Creative Commons paraissent répondre à nos besoins (CC BY-NC-ND 4.0 ou CC BY-NC-SA 4.0)
- demander à l'ESO quelle licence est appliquée (action Xavier, en attente de la réponse de l'ESO)
Points prioritaires /indispensables du point de vue utilisateur pour notre V1.0
- Valider la suffisance des méta-données actuelles
Tout n'est pas couvert dans ce qui est listé, mais ca suffit pour lancer OIDB 1.0 !
- La soumission de fichier oifits valides.
L'equipe technique y travailera la dernière semaine de janvier. Besoin de règles plus strictes, si SEVERE ERROR, rejeter le fichier (input ticket
#607)
Check List mise en production
Technique
Point |
Etat |
Remarque |
Basculer la VM de prod sous le nom oidb.jmmc.fr |
KO |
MAJ DNS Gandy, HTTPS sera avec un certificat sur lequel l'utilisateur devra accepter restera la gestion du certificat https de confiance avec IPAM UJF |
Sauvegarde quotidienne |
KO |
export fichiers plats de la base xml & sql / synchro sur le serveur principal |
Mecanisme bascule/affichage en maintenance |
KO |
creer la page en maintenance + regle de redirection apache |
Activer le rejet par le validateur |
en cours |
Definir des regles plus strictes à la validation, ticket #607 |
Implementer le support de OFFSET dans les requets ADQL |
|
|
|
|
|
Documentation
Procedure d'installation / maintenance |
OK |
|
Doc utilisateur |
KO |
à relire et finaliser |
Mise à jour des données de correspondant à la DSI |
|
|
Données
Enregistrer l'ensemble des données suivante
Point |
Etat |
Remarque |
Collection CLIMB/CLASSIC |
|
|
Collection VEGA |
|
|
Collection PIONIER |
|
|
Collection Vizier |
|
J/A+A/545/A130 J/A+A/559/A111 J/A+A/558/A24 J/A+A/558/A149 J/A+A/544/A91 J/A+A/493/L17 J/A+A/536/A55 J/A+A/565/A71 |
Vérifier/activer les synchros régulières |
|
|
|
|
|
- Denis va vérifier des petites incohérences sur les données de la collection L0 VEGA
- L0-ESO: après discussion, l'OIDB va donc aller chercher dans les pages des archives les metadata des données L0 (pas d'accès ftp aux fichiers pour l'instant).
Actions régulières:
- synchroniser les collections
- PIONIER tt les ??
- VEGA tt les ??
- mettre a jour les .htaccess (passage en public des données sous embargo) tt les jours
Tests
- Soumission d'oifits qui ne sont pas acceptables selon les règles du ticket #607 (Action: tous les astronomes du groupe OIDB).
- Les remarques suite à ces tests sont à rapporter dans les ticket #648 (formulaire de soumission) et #636 (aspect technique de l'upload local).
Calendrier
- 6 février 2015 à 13h, réunion pour boucler sur les développements techniques et faire le point sur les tests de soumission.
- fin février, annonce de la mise en service d'OIDB 1.0, (faire teaser YouTube?)